Incredibly beautiful, solid copper Indra, probably from India or Nepal. Supremely beautiful, finely cast, exquisitely modeled. Near masterpiece. Cast of a high quality alloy. This piece measures 4 1/2 inches tall and 6 1/4 inches with its custom base. Solid cast. Looks to have been completely gilded at one time. Some dings and has been cleaned at various times but overall condition is excellent. This is one piece that cleaning has not hurt, because the quality of the underlying alloy is very high (containing precious metal I think), and the varying layers (light, dark, traces of gilding, all with the mirror-like surface) manage to come together to create a unique and beautiful surface that would be near impossible to fake. I've had different opinions on age from several hundred years old to 20thC. The dings and flattening on the underside and the remains of gilding (which look to be correct and not to be added to deceive) do suggest real age. I will give the best possible photos and leave it for the buyer to decide. It is not the typical Nepalese type, which is hollow, and usually cast of bronze, nor is it like any Indian example I've seen, though not sure where else it could possible be from. Seems like it may have been made by a jeweler as a "one of" in the 19thC. I leave it for you to decide.
